Confirmed season count and status
As of mid-2025, The Last of Us has 2 released seasons and a 3rd season officially ordered and in production. The series has been renewed through at least Season 3 at HBO. Future renewals beyond Season 3 have not been publicly confirmed. Below is a concise table summarizing season status and episode counts where available.
Season status and episode overview table
| Season | Episodes | Release year | Status |
|---|---|---|---|
| Season 1 | 9 | 2023 | Released |
| Season 2 | 8 | 2025 | Released |
| Season 3 | TBD | TBA | In production |
Season 1 recap and milestones
Season 1 introduced Joel and Ellie across the post-pandemic United States, covering roughly the first half of the first game. It delivered strong character work, grounded action, and careful adaptation choices. Milestones included strong launch ratings and broad critical praise, establishing the series as a premium drama within the gaming adaptation space.
